> V4: Applied code review comments - removed APIs that are not being
> used.
>
> V1: Add Null versions of the ProtectedVariable Library.
> This will be the default libraries for platforms that
> do not support ProtectedVariable.

> @@ -0,0 +1,34 @@
> +## @file
> +# Provides null version of protected variable services.
> +#
> +# Copyright (c) 2022, Intel Corporation. All rights reserved.<BR>
> +# SPDX-License-Identifier: BSD-2-Clause-Patent
> +#
> +##
> +
> +[Defines]
> + INF_VERSION = 0x00010029
> + BASE_NAME = ProtectedVariableLibNull
> + FILE_GUID = 352C6A1B-403A-4E37-8517-FAA50BC45251
> + MODULE_TYPE = BASE
> + VERSION_STRING = 0.1
> + LIBRARY_CLASS = ProtectedVariableLib
> +
> +#
> +# The following information is for reference only and not required by the build
> tools.
> +#
> +# VALID_ARCHITECTURES = IA32 X64
> +#
> +
> +[Sources]
> + ProtectedVariable.c
> +
> +[Packages]
> + MdePkg/MdePkg.dec
> + MdeModulePkg/MdeModulePkg.dec
> +
> +[LibraryClasses]
> + BaseLib
> + BaseMemoryLib
> + DebugLib
> +
